The website "Topless Robot" has posted a really scathing review of the pilot, which their reviewer obtained. Apparently the actress was good, and that's just about the only thing he found appealing about the pilot.

http://www.toplessrobot.com/2011/06/robs_wonder_woman_tv_pilot_faq.php

His description of a fight scene in which WW kills a man in cold blood is rather shocking. This isn't a Maxwell Lord scenario, either. It's the same violation of tone that made the animated WW film of a few years ago (in which WW acts more like a Jane Bond in a couple of scenes than a superhero) a bit of a disappointment.

Though by reading that review a questionable act by WW (one of several - I didn't mention the torture sequence) is the least of the pilot's worries.

I still want to see it out of curiosity, but unless they planned to do a "Second episode reboot" like some shows have done, I probably wouldn't have cared for it had it gone to air. (To be fair, however, much as ABC forced "Good Christian B**ches" to change its title, and there have been countless cases of shows being required to change cast members after the pilot, there's no guarantee things like throwing a pipe through a guy's neck or torturing a man for info - while a police officer stands by and does nothing to intervene, yet - would have ever actually made it on to NBC had the bought the show.)
